The “his innards sucked out by a hot tub” is a reference to a short horror story in a collection by the guy who wrote “Fight Club” Chuck Palahnuik.
Tell me more…
@@violentlypink6680 the story is called “Guts” in his book of short stories called “Haunted” from 2005
